U0100 – BMW DTC

BMW DTC U0100 – Lost Communication With ECM/PCM ‘A’

DTC U0100 meaning on BMW

The DTC U0100 code on a BMW indicates a communication error between the Engine Control Module (ECM) or Powertrain Control Module (PCM) and another control module in the vehicle. This code specifically refers to a lost communication with ECM/PCM ‘A’.

BMW DTC U0100 symptoms

Symptoms of a DTC U0100 code on a BMW may include:

  • Check Engine Light (CEL) illuminated
  • Engine running rough or stalling
  • Problems with transmission shifting
  • Limited vehicle performance

BMW DTC U0100 causes

The potential causes of a DTC U0100 code on a BMW include:

  • Faulty ECM/PCM
  • Wiring or connection issues between modules
  • Software glitches or updates
  • Interference from aftermarket electronic devices

BMW DTC U0100 seriousness

The DTC U0100 code should be addressed promptly as it can lead to drivability issues and potential safety concerns. Ignoring this code may result in further damage to the vehicle’s systems.

How to diagnose DTC U0100 on BMW

To diagnose a DTC U0100 code on a BMW, follow these steps:

  1. Use an OBD-II scanner to retrieve the specific fault codes.
  2. Check for any other related codes or symptoms.
  3. Inspect the wiring and connections between the ECM/PCM and other modules.
  4. Perform a software update or reflash if necessary.

How to fix DTC U0100 on BMW

To fix a DTC U0100 code on a BMW, consider the following:

  1. Repair or replace any faulty ECM/PCM.
  2. Address any wiring or connection issues between modules.
  3. Ensure all software updates are current.
  4. Remove any aftermarket electronic devices causing interference.

How to erase DTC U0100 on BMW

To erase a DTC U0100 code on a BMW, you can use an OBD-II scanner to clear the code after the underlying issue has been resolved. This will reset the Check Engine Light and allow you to monitor the system for any reoccurrence of the fault code.